Is your code crashing, too slow, or not doing what you expected? Submit a report here and we will make a short curriculum module demonstrating what we think is best practice. Some examples of the scope of possible bugs are:
- Large raster files are crashing Python
- Can't get hdf5 files loaded
- Can't tile rasters or load multiple files into the same dataset
Any specific problem you have been working on for more than an hour with no progress is a good candidate. It counts as a problem if your code works but is really slow!
Once you have identified a specific problem you need to solve:
- Submit an issue using the bug template to this repository, answering all questions in the template. It is especially important to include a clear description of what is happening when you run your code, including any error messages you receive.
- Fork this repository
- Produce an MRE in a directory labelled --.
- Include the smallest amount of data that reproduces a problem (e.g. if you have 500 files, but the problem occurs with 2 files, just include 2 files). If you can't put your data on GitHub because it's too large or sensitive, place it somewhere accessible like OneDrive.
- Add and commit your files, and then create a pull request using the template. Pay close attention to the MRE checklist in the PR template.
- Send an email to the instructor with a link to your pull request, in case the automated emails don't go through.
We'll try to resolve the issue before the next class period and share the results with the class. The solutions will be presented to the class and posted to earthdatascience.org, with any sensitive information or data removed.
